While I agree with both of you, the key is will they get pressure on AR with the blitz? If they can, then yes loading the box and blitzing will make it difficult on the Packers offense. If they do not get pressure, then AR should be able to beat them; especially, if they are blitzing LB's and not getting there. It is a risky proposition, IMO.
I think we have more trouble with defenses that can get pressure with their front 4, play physical tight man, and keep their LB's in the middle for quick dump offs and crossing routes. They can also keep two deep safeties to prevent one on one deep balls which we know AR likes to throw. We should be able to run the ball on these defenses but I have not really seen us do it consistently.
